Как настроить разработку Django, JavaScript с помощью Docker и статических файлов? Получение изменений веб-страницы в реальном времени

В настоящее время у меня есть контейнер Docker. Процесс с main.js:

  1. npm renders main.js and store it in static folder (out of the docker container)
  2. Docker compose and docker file collects static files in static-volume, including main.js
  3. Nginx serves main.js from static-volume

Но когда я вношу изменения в исходный код, я могу увидеть результаты только после перезапуска контейнера и команды "docker volume prune".

Я хочу, чтобы изменения веб-страницы происходили сразу после изменения кода. Какова наилучшая практика в этом сценарии?

Вернуться на верх